Output dfd3b62c4e842ffa46b1a91df68cc7c6c7368884005a08f4d9bb5f4de23f4502:0

value
1005007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a3bbe73a702ce0634bfa67b387675589692d7a OP_EQUAL
address
2MvK6S3xt7p84MvJDmigRMQK9KdSbLWhMSL
transaction
dfd3b62c4e842ffa46b1a91df68cc7c6c7368884005a08f4d9bb5f4de23f4502
confirmations
101335
spent
true